Hello,
I would like to ask developers to please consider players with vision impairments when you design BGA games. Due to my vision impairment, I must have my screen in dark mode. Splendor was one of my favourite games until the new graphics appeared. With the new graphics, I can no longer see the Splendor cards and coins properly. As a result, I will no longer be able to play Splendor (unless BGA reverts to the old style Splendor graphics), and likely will not be renewing my Premium membership. Please developers do better to make BGA a more accessible site for players with vision impairments.

As one WITHOUT any vision impairment, I find the Splendor re-design appalling and useless. Colors and a variety of necessary information to play the game properly are now harder to distinguish. If I find it difficult, I can only imagine what other players with impairments are experiencing.

Also, moving the location of crucial game information (E.g. Noble Cards values) changes the whole thing.
Gemstone colors on the cards are over-complicated designs and tough to figure out. I'm sure someone thinks it looks 'so pretty' but GBA is ruining it for players. And the likes of me, who PAY for the pleasure, are now considering ending their years long subscriptions.
